Abstract
La presente tesis reporta una investigación realizada sobre la influencia del Burnout
laboral sobre la Motivación en las tareas profesionales del profesorado de cuatro
instituciones educativas públicas del distrito de San Juan de Miraflores. La muestra al azar
estratificada estuvo constituida por 154 profesores. La investigación tuvo un enfoque
cuantitativo, fue de tipo aplicado empírico, con metodología correlacional, y diseño
transeccional no experimental. Se aplicaron para la recolección de información la Escala
de Desgaste Ocupacional de Profesores y el Work Tasks Motivation Scale for Teachers. La
validez de contenido y confiabilidad de dichos instrumentos se corroboraron
respectivamente con el coeficiente de validez de Aiken y el coeficiente Alfa de Crobach.
Los datos recolectados se procesaron con la escala de estanones para los niveles
cualitativos de las variables estudiadas, y con la prueba estadística paramétrica correlación
de Pearson (r) para la evaluación de la hipótesis general y de las hipótesis específicas. Los
resultados evidenciaron la existencia de una influencia negativa y moderada del burnout
laboral docente sobre la motivación para las tareas profesionales del profesorado de las
instituciones educativas estudiadas, así como sobre la motivación identificada y la
motivación incorporada para las tareas profesionales del profesorado participante,
mientras que influyó de manera negativa alta en la motivación intrínseca para las tareas
docentes. Por otra parte, se observó una influencia positiva alta del burnout laboral sobre la
motivación externa y la desmotivación para las tareas profesionales enraizada en el
profesorado de las instituciones educativas “Peruano Canadiense”, “Elías Aguirre”,
“Solidaridad Peruano Alemania” y “Perú Valladolid” de San Juan de Miraflores. Los
hallazgos resultaron estadísticamente significativos a un nivel de probabilidad de p=0,05.
This thesis reports research on the influence of the Labor Burnout on Motivation in the professional tasks of the faculty of four public educational institutions in the district of San Juan de Miraflores. The randomized stratified sample consisted of 154 teachers. The research had a quantitative approach, was empirical applied type, with correlal methodology, and non-experimental transsectal design. The Teacher Occupational Wear Scale and the Work Tasks Motivation Scale for Teachers were applied for information collection. The validity of content and reliability of these instruments were corroborated respectively by the Aiken validity coefficient and the Crobach Alpha coefficient. The collected data were processed with the stanone scale for the qualitative levels of the variables studied, and with the Pearson correlation parametric statistical test (r) for the evaluation of the general hypothesis and specific hypotheses. The results showed the existence of a negative and moderate influence of the teaching work burnout on the motivation for the professional tasks of the teachers of the educational institutions studied, as well as on the identified motivation and the built-in motivation for the professional tasks of the participating teachers, while it negatively influenced in a high negative way the intrinsic motivation for teaching tasks. On the other hand, there was a high positive influence of the labor burnout on external motivation and demotivation for professional tasks rooted in the teachers of the educational institutions "Peruano Canadiense", "Elías Aguirre", "Solidaridad Peruano Alemania" and "Peru Valladolid" of San Juan de Miraflores. The findings were statistically significant at a probability level of p.0.05.
